What You’ll Do Day-to-Day: 

  • Diagnose, troubleshoot, and repair Toyota and other makes of lift trucks and heavy-duty material handling equipment. 
  • Perform preventative maintenance per manufacture specifications on material handling equipment, stackers, electric tow trucks, and transporters.
  • Safely operate grinders, drill presses, air compressors, and other common hand and power tools in accordance with company safety standards.
  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of all products sold and serviced by Atlas.
  • Maintain personal technician tools and equipment for safe and efficient daily operations.
  • Complete service repair assignments in timely manner.
  • Maintain a clean and organized work area while adhering to all safety guidelines.
  • Participate in monthly safety inspections and toolbox talks to promote a safe work environment and ensure compliance with company safety standards and procedures.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.


Requirements

What You’ll Need to Succeed: 

  • Must possess a valid driver's license and the ability to maintain a good driving record.  
  • Strong mechanical, electrical, and equipment repair skills.
  • Experience troubleshooting, repairing, and maintaining industrial or automotive equipment.
  • Knowledge of the use of hand tools and measuring devices.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ills. 
  • A willingness to learn and participate in ongoing training.
  • Customer service oriented with strong communication and interpersonal skills.
  • The ability to manage time and attendance. We are looking for self-motivated individuals who can work with minimal supervision.

Physical Requirements and Working Conditions:

  • This position requires but is not limited to standing, bending, crouching, twisting, pulling, pushing, and lifting to 80 lbs., routinely 20-50 lbs.
  • Field Technician Positions: Regular travel within an assigned territory is required; the ability to operate a motor vehicle is necessary for this role.
